Ma’An vs Faro Climate & Distance Between

Portugal flag
  • The distance between Ma’An, Jordan and Faro, Portugal is approximately 4,087 km or 2,540 mi.
  • To reach Ma’An in this distance one would set out from Faro bearing 87.6°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Ma’An bearing 112.7° or ESE .
  • Ma’An has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Faro has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
  • Ma’An is in or near the warm temperate desert biome whereas Faro is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 0.1 °C (0.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.6 °C (11.9°F) more in Ma’An.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 479.3 mm (18.9 in) less which is equivalent to 479.3 l/m² (11.76 US gal/ft²) or 4,793,000 l/ha (512,404 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.8° higher in Ma’An than in Faro.
